Former Employee Admits To $1.5 Million In Theft

MONTGOMERY, Ala.–A former employee of IAM Community Federal Credit Union has pleaded guilty to financial institution theft, including agreeing to pay approximately $1.5 million in restitution.

Jennifer Arnette entered the plea Monday in U.S. District Court in Montgomery. Arnette was formerly a branch manager and loan officer with the credit union.

As part of her guilty plea, Arnette admitted to several means of embezzling and misapplying funds from the credit union while she worked there until March of 2013, the Dothan Eagle reported.

According to court documents quoted by the Dothan Eagle, Arnette admitted to the following actions:

  • Using her position to manipulate credit scores to authorize approximately 170 automobile loan applications, causing the credit union to issue loans beyond the credit union’s accepted level of risk.
  • Approving approximately 64 automobile loans wherein she inflated the value of the automobiles by listing premium options that never existed, including a premium engine, sports package, upgraded body type, theft recovery system and others. Approximately 22 of the loans were manipulated to inflate the value of the automobiles more than $5,000 each. The fraud caused IAM to issue automobile loans without sufficient collateral.
  • Unilaterally increasing her personal loan limit and falsely making it appear the credit union CEO authorized the increase.
  • Stealing $9,393.35 from a deceased credit union member by transferring funds from the deceased member’s account to another member’s account, then ultimately to her own personal account at another institution.
  • Unlawfully withdrawing $80,000 from the IAM cash account.

The plea agreement indicates the amount of restitution owed of $1.1 million to IAM Community Federal Credit Union and $386,589.99 to CUNA Mutual Group, the Dothan Eagle reported.

Her sentence has not been set, but Arnette is due for a reduction in sentencing range for cooperating with the investigation and pleading to the offense.
